Associate Accidents and Injuries

Overview

Under the Worker's Compensation Act, compensation for injury arising in the course of your employment is provided. This program covers the costs that arise when you are injured while at work. Benefits vary state by state, but generally, your medical expenses are covered along with a portion of your lost wages, if you are unable to return to work. 

All on-the-job accidents, whether a claim is made or not, must be reported immediately to your manager and to either your Benefits or Human Resources Consultant (HRC).

If you sustain an on-the-job injury, you are responsible for the following:

  • Reporting the incident immediately to your manager/supervisor
  • Seeking appropriate medical treatment with the assistance of your manager/supervisor and Benefits team
  • Completing any forms or statements that are required by the Bank
  • Obtaining and providing to your manager/supervisor and Benefits a physician's statement regarding your ability to return to work
  • Following the physician's treatment plan and any restrictions
  • Attending all medical appointments related to your injury or claim
  • Reporting any changes in your medical status
  • Communicating with your Claim team, the individuals involved in your rehabilitation, claim, and return-to-work process
  • Obtaining a full duty release from your physician when medically able

Seeking Treatment

Your manager/supervisor, along with the Benefits team, will assist you in obtaining appropriate medical treatment, depending on the severity of the situation. They will provide you with any necessary paperwork or forms and can help you complete them, should you need assistance.

If the physician orders temporary restrictions to return to work, you must follow his/her instructions carefully, both at home and at work, to avoid re-injury.

Return to Work

The Bank is committed to offering injured associates active and continued participation in the workforce during your rehabilitation process, whenever possible. 

You have the opportunity to gradually return to regular work or be granted time for reconditioning to the demands of your position through a modified schedule. Job requirements will be coordinated with your manager and physician. 

Where appropriate, you may be offered an alternative work arrangement, either in your department or in a different department. Alternative or modified work is limited to a specific duration and is designed to help you reach your pre-injury status in a safe and timely manner.

Claim Team

If you sustain an injury that necessitates filing a worker's compensation claim, several individuals will contact you to assist collect information to process your claim, including:

  • Manager/Supervisor - Your manager/supervisor will remain in contact with you weekly while you are unable to work and will assist with your return-to-work plan.
  • Benefits Team - Your Benefits team member will remain in contact with you periodically, and provide liaison assistance between the Bank and the workers' compensation carrier, as needed.
  • Claim Adjuster - This is a claim professional who is responsible for investigating, validating, and making payments for your claim. This is your contact for any payment issues.
  • Case Manager - In some instances, a nurse case manager or rehabilitation professional is assigned to assist with the medical and return-to-work aspects of your claim.
  • Medical Provider(s) - These include physicians, specialists, independent examiners, and therapists. Contact these individuals with any treatment concerns.

You are expected to work cooperatively with each of the members of your claim team. They are working on your behalf to assist you in achieving a complete recovery.
